6.5ftx300ft Weed Barrier Landscape Fabric Heavy Duty, Premium 3…

Rating: 137 reviews from 1 sources

Reviews

Selected Review of 137 Reviews

It's not bad , should be a little bit sicker and a little bit wider for the price I paidRead full review

www.amazon.com